กล้า ไม่ได้แปลว่าไม่กลัว

คนที่มีความกล้านั้น ไม่ได้แปลว่าเขาไม่กลัว ความจริงแล้ว คนกล้าคือคนที่รู้จักควบคุมความกลัวของตนเอง อันที่จริงสิ่งที่เขาควบคุมหาใช่ตัวความกลัวเองไม่ แต่เป็นการควบคุมสิ่งที่ทำให้เกิดความกลัวขึ้นต่างหาก

สิ่งที่ทำให้เกิดความกลัวนั้น คือ ความเสี่ยง เหตุผลที่คนส่วนใหญ่ไม่กล้าที่จะลงทุนก็คือ ความเสี่ยง เหตุผลที่เราไม่กล้าตามหาฝันก็คือ ความเสี่ยง เหตุผลที่เราไม่สามารถสารภาพรักกับคนที่เรามีใจให้ก็คือความเสี่ยง ความแตกต่างระหว่าง คนกล้า และ คนขลาดก็คือ การที่คนกล้า ออกไปเผชิญหน้ากับความเสี่ยง ส่วนคนขลาด นอนขดตัวด้วยความกลัว แล้วบอกกับตัวเองว่า อย่างนี้ปลอดภัยกว่า

สิ่งที่ คนกล้า สามารถเอาชนะความเสี่ยงได้ ไม่ใช่การทดลองอย่างบ้าบิ่น แต่เป็นการที่พวกเขารู้จักประเมิน และลดความเสี่ยงลง จนอยู่ในระดับที่จัดการได้

ในการพัฒนาซอฟแวร์นั้น ปัจจัยปัญหาอันหนึ่งที่สำคัญคงหนีไม่พ้น ความเสี่ยง ไม่ว่าจะเป็นความเสี่ยง ของไม่รู้ ไม่รู้ว่า solution ที่คิดไว้จะใช้การได้จริงหรือไม่ library ที่นำมา ใช้ได้ตามที่ต้องการหรือไม่ timeframe ที่กำหนด เป็นไปได้จริงหรือไม่ ฯลฯ ความสำเร็จหรือความล้มเหลว ในโครงการพัฒนาซอฟแวร์จึงไม่ได้มาจากโชค หรือ ฟลุ๊ก แต่มาจากความสามารถในการจัดการความเสี่ยงของทีมพัฒนา

อไจล์เป็นเครื่องมือหนึ่งที่ช่วยให้เราสามารถควบคุมความเสี่ยงนั้นได้ดีขึ้น การแบ่งการพัฒนาออกเป็น iteration การแบ่ง requirements ของเป็น story การทดสอบตลาดแบบ A/B testing การใช้ Test Driven Development ทั้งหมด เป็นเครื่องมือเพื่อลดความเสี่ยงทั้งนั้น

สิ่งสำคัญที่ต้องจำคือ อไจล์ไม่ได้สามารถลดความเสี่ยงลงจนเหลือ 0 แต่มุ่งเป้าไปที่การที่เราสามารถลดผลกระทบจากความผิดพลาด และปรับเปลี่ยนทิศทางไปยังแนวทางที่ถูกต้องได้โดยใช้ cost ต่ำที่สุด สิ่งสำคัญในการใช้อไจล์ให้มีประสิทธิภาพจึงไม่ใช่การสามารถทำได้ถูกต้องตั้งแต่ต้น แต่เป็นการเรียนรู้และปรับเปลี่ยนอย่างรวดเร็วจนดูเหมือนไม่เคยผิดเลยต่างหาก จึงจะเป็นอไจล์อย่างแท้จริง

คุณทำ Retrospectives ครั้งสุดท้ายเมื่อไร? และอะไรคือ action items ที่ได้มา? และทำให้เกิดผลไปกี่ items แล้ว?

Advertisements

ใส่ความเห็น

Please log in using one of these methods to post your comment: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/ เปลี่ยนแปลง )

Twitter picture

You are commenting using your Twitter account. Log Out / เปลี่ยนแปลง )

Facebook photo

You are commenting using your Facebook account. Log Out / เปลี่ยนแปลง )

Google+ photo

You are commenting using your Google+ account. Log Out / เปลี่ยนแปลง )

Connecting to %s